- PLANNING ADVISORY COMMISSION RECOMMENDATION
- The Planning Advisory Commission recommends approval based upon the fact that
although it is not consistent with the future land-use map of the 2001 Bibb
City addition to the 1998 Comprehensive Plan, it is consistent with Commercial
Development policy statements #1 and #2, and it does not constitute spot
zoning.
- PLANNING DEPARTMENT RECOMMENDATION
- Approval based on the fact that it is consistent with Commercial Development
policy statement #1 and it is compatible with existing land-uses.
The 2003 Comprehensive Plan update will be amended to change the land-use of
this area of Bibb City to General Commercial.

- Environmental Impacts
- The property does not lie within a floodway and floodplain area. The developer
will need an approved drainage plan prior to issuance of a Site Development
permit, if a permit is required
- City Services
- Property is served by all city services.
- Traffic Impact
- The proposed project is not expected to have a negative impact on the
transportation network. The current traffic count is 24,436 trips per day and
will increase to 24,757 (combined with 3715 2nd Avenue) trips per day. The
Level Of Service will remain at C (27,900 trips per day) for 2nd Avenue.
